Choose the Right Garage Door


Set a Budget


Find out how much you are willing to spend on your garage door. All material costs, installation charges, and additional items (e.g., automation, insulation) should be considered. Having a clear budget guarantees that you do not overspend while still receiving the things you require.




Research Garage Door Options


Explore different materials and patterns to find one that complements your garage. Steel, aluminium, and timber doors all have distinct characteristics. Steel doors are strong, aluminium cannot rust, and timber looks good.




Consider Your Needs


Think about the door’s purpose. When your garage is a workshop, think about an insulated garage door to help maintain a comfortable temperature. If the metal will be used frequently then a hard metal like steel or aluminum should be selected.




Call a Garage Door Professional


Talk to experts who can advise you based on your requirements and expenses. They can help you navigate choices and recommend reliable brands.




Choose a Door Type


Pick a type that suits your space and preferences. Sectional doors are suitable for very small areas, while tilt doors are adapted for very small areas with limited ceiling level.




Select a Colour or Finish


Select a finish or colour that will work with the outside paint of your garage. Neutral tones (white, grey, and beige) are in vogue, and custom finishes provide the means to give an individual appearance.




Designs of Garage Doors



Steel Garage Doors


Steel doors are sturdy, durable, and low maintenance. They are dent-resistant and can withstand heavy use.




Aluminium Garage Doors


Aluminium doors are lightweight and rustproof. They are great for use in humid or marine environments.




Timber Garage Doors


Wooden doors provide a timeless aesthetic. They need to be serviced frequently, but they also provide comfort and a sense of sophistication to your property.




Tilt Garage Doors


Tilt doors open outwards and upward in the same way. They are perfect for garages with limited overhead space.




Roller Garage Doors


Roller doors roll onto a nested drum above the opening. They save space and are easy to automate.




Sectional Garage Doors


Sectional doors are made up of several panels that move along the roof by sliding up and folding themselves along the ceiling. They’re versatile and stylish.




Custom Garage Doors


Custom doors allow you to choose the materials, colours, and patterns that best suit your preferences





Prepare for Installation



Clear the Garage Area


Remove objects in the vicinity of the garage door, each with a minimum of three meters of clear airspace. A clear area prevents accidents during installation.




Move Vehicles Outside


Park your vehicles away from the garage. This provides sparing and allows the installers more room to install.




Remove Decorations and Fixtures


Remove shelves and hooks as well as other wall fixtures from garage walls in the vicinity of the installation location.




Store Loose Items


Store tools, boxes, and other items somewhere else. This keeps the workspace safe and clutter-free.




Clean the Garage Floor


Sweep the floor to remove dust and debris. A clean workspace ensures accurate measurements and smooth installation.

Step-by-Step Installation Process



Step 1: Remove the Old Door


Detach the existing door carefully. Start by removing the panels, springs, and tracks.




Step 2: Disconnect the Old Door Opener


If replacing an automated system, disconnect the door opener from power and dismantle its components.




Step 3: Install Reinforcing Bars


Attach reinforcing bars to the new panels. These bars add strength and stability to the door.




Step 4: Add Hinges


Secure hinges to the door panels. They allow the panels to slide very smoothly when the door is opened and closed.




Step 5: Attach Support Brackets


Fit support brackets to offload the door load so that it is supported and therefore strong long-term.




Step 6: Fit the Panels


Place the bottom panel in position and level. Add subsequent panels, aligning them carefully.




Step 7: Secure Hinges and Tracks


Attach the tracks and tighten the hinges. Proper positioning prevents the door from jamming or clanging.




Step 8: Install Springs and Cables


Attach torsion/extension spring and cable tie down to the drums. Follow safety instructions to avoid injury.




Step 9: Tighten Springs


Set the spring tension so the door operates properly. Test to confirm the proper balance.




Step 10: Mount the Door Opener


Install the door opener if automating the system. Test the remote control and safety features.





Garage Door Parts Checklist



Door Opener


The opener adds convenience and security. Choose one with modern safety features.




Panels


These form the main structure of the door. Choose robust, insulated panels for reliability and energy effectiveness.




Springs


Springs balance the door’s weight. Torsion springs are appropriate for heavy doors, and extension springs are for light doors.




Tracks


Tracks guide the door’s movement. Ensure they are securely fastened and properly aligned.




Cables


Cables trigger what are called discrete feedback springs, which lift, lower and close (latch) the door. Use high-quality cables for safety.




Rollers


Rollers help the door glide smoothly along the tracks. Nylon rollers are quieter and longer-lasting.




Weather Seals


Install seals to keep out drafts, water, and pests. Replace damaged seals promptly.




Safety Sensors


Sensors detect contact with obstacles and close a door to prevent accidents. Test them regularly.




Emergency Cord


Manually the emergency wire can be switched on in the event of a power cutout. Ensure it is accessible and functional.
